Depuis plus d'un demi-siècle, DeVilbiss Healthcare offre une sécurité et des performances inégalées dans le domaine des dispositifs d'aspiration des voies respiratoires. Avec le Vacu-Aide QSU, DeVilbiss vous offre la même fiabilité et la même portabilité, dans un appareil nettement plus silencieux. Avec une réduction du bruit de plus de 50 %, le Vacu-Aide QSU est l'appareil portable à haut débit et haute aspiration le plus silencieux du marché, ce qui en fait un choix judicieux pour les patients, du nouveau-né à l'adulte.
Caractéristiques et avantages- Le réglage du vide permet une pression de 50 à 550 mm Hg et un débit libre de 27 lpm
- Conforme aux directives de l'American Association for Respiratory Care (AARC) pour l'aspiration à domicile des nouveau-nés, des nourrissons, des enfants et des adultes
- Peut ramener rapidement un patient à un état de confort ; Conforme à la norme ISO 10079-1:2009 relative au vide élevé et au débit élevé
- Un nouvel ensemble de conteneurs innovant doté d'un filtre antibactérien intégré
- La conception du conteneur et du filtre maintient un débit approprié pour répondre aux directives ISO
- Nouvelle jauge intégrée et régulateur de débit avec bouton facile à tourner, idéalement placé autour de la jauge pour une utilisation et un contrôle faciles
- Fabriqué et testé selon la norme ISO10079-1:1999 pour les équipements d'aspiration, obtenant des performances exceptionnelles lors des tests de compatibilité électromagnétique, des tests de chute et de vibration de choc et des tests de température excessive
Modèle n° 7314d-d, 7314p-d, 7314p-d-exf

First, as an addition to the initial review, here’s what I did to help with the pump noise. I also got some extension suction tubing - McKesson 12” x 1/4’ ID (part # 16-66307). I also got a remote control extension power strip. The pump goes in the closet; the closet door is shut; the tubing and electrical cord fit under the closet door; and I can easily lay down in bed and run the pump as needed from bed using the remote control without having to get up. Super Quiet! The product works as advertised. However, TruClear’s instructions about how to set the pressure levels (both in their printed materials and in their videos) could be clearer. You have to carefully read the separate pump instructions to learn how to do it. It’s not just a matter of simply turning the pressure valve - you have to simultaneously occlude or plug the patient port in order to adjust the pressure level. In addition, since I am circumcised,I originally ordered the M+ catheter (recommended by TruClear for hose who are circumcised). I found it to be too small and it resulted in leaks. I ordered the regular M catheter (supposedly for those who are uncircumcised) and it worked great.

I have been using the Demetech UR24T Vacu-Aide portable aspirator with the Truclr male condom catheter for more than three months now. I was getting up to urinate more than 6 times every night which caused me to lose a lot of sleep. I've tried medication, herbs, not drinking after 5pm and using other devices that just did not work to resolve my bladder & prostate issues. My grandson discovered the UR24T & the Truclr condom online and I decided to order them. It took me less than a week to get used to using it. The condom is made of a soft silicone material and it goes on my ***** quickly & easily. My body adjusted to it in a short time and I found myself getting more sleep and waking up less. Now I'm getting a better night's sleep and feeling more rested during the day! No more getting up a half dozen or more times a night. The Demetch UR24T vacu-aide aspirator is somewhat noisy for me, so I added an extension tubing to the catheter and placed the unit just outside my bedroom and it made a significant difference for me. The sound may not be a problem for you. In the morning I remove the catheter and shut the unit off. The suction canister that comes with the unit works great but didn't hold the volume of urine I needed it to, so I ordered a larger 2000cc suction canister from Amazon and it works well for me. After I get up I empty the canister, clean it and flush the tubing with hydrogen peroxide. The catheter comes with a bottle of antibacterial cleaner. I clean and dry the silicone catheter and I'm ready for the next night (the catheter is reusable and lasts for weeks) . These devices are covered by Medicare as well. The company can provide the billing codes for you. I am happy with the results I'm getting using this.
